About the Role
As a Logistics Coordinator at Zekelman Industries, you will play a key role in managing and optimizing plant logistics operations.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, enjoys problem-solving, and has strong organizational skills. This position is based in Chicago, IL and will work closely with our Rochelle, IL facility.

What You’ll Do

  • Dispatching and scheduling truck loads, as well as ensuring other aspects of the logistics teams needs are met.

  • Schedule delivery appointments at customer to accommodate on-time deliveries.

  • Maintain relationships with Zekelman carrier base; ensure all carriers abide by Zekelman rules and regulations.

  • Scheduled loads to maximize shipments

  • Use a combination of our TMS system, email and phone to ensure all loads are covered to meet customer fill rate requirements.

  • Research and implement ways to decrease costs whenever possible without hindering customer services

  • Communicate with your manager and the sales department on any customer service issue as it relates to carriers.

  • Coordinate with warehouses\shipping department to increase loading efficiencies.

  • Proactive communication with your manager, sales & operations
